Looking to put a cap on the regular season this week, the PGA TOUR heads to North Carolina for the Wyndham Championship.

There will be 156 golfers pegging it to start the week with the top 65 and ties playing the weekend.

With a full field like this, finding six golfers to make it through the cut line is of utmost importance when building Yahoo DFS lineups.

Let’s look at putting performance on bermudagrass greens and then look at past performance in the region to see if we can dig up some value nuggets.

Finding a Hot Putter

Longtime gamers know that finding the “hot putter” in any given week is no easy task.

However, we can find some likely candidates by looking at past performance on bermudagrass greens.

Let’s hop over to the NBC Sports Edge Driver tool and see who is averaging the most strokes gained putting per round on courses with bermuda greens, since the start of the 2019 campaign:

Denny McCarthy
Patton Kizzire
Brendon Todd
Rhein Gibson
J.T. Poston
Peter Malnati
Webb Simpson
Andrew Putnam
Kiradech Aphibarnrat
Kris Ventura
Michael Thompson
Sungjae Im
Chesson Hadley
Matt Kuchar
Louis Oosthuizen

Patton Kizzire ($32): If you are looking for someone that can go nuclear with the flat stick, Kizzire is a great option. He has 27 instances of gaining at least four strokes putting in a given week on the PGA TOUR. That includes +7.2 SGP at the 2019 Wyndham and +5.4 SGP last year.

Regional Comfort

They are playing in Greensboro, North Carolina, this week.

There are four states that border North Carolina. Let’s take a simple view of performance in NC and the four surrounding states, to see who plays well in the region.

Using the NBC Sports Edge Driver tool again, here are the top performers (strokes gained total per round) in those five states, since the start of the 2019 season:

Webb Simpson
Will Zalatoris
Camilo Villegas
Jhonattan Vegas
Kyle Stanley
Rickie Fowler
Joel Dahmen
Brian Harman
Seamus Power
Hideki Matsuyama
Rob Oppenheim
Matthew NeSmith
Will Gordon
J.T. Poston
Brian Stuard

Seamus Power ($31): He is a Charlotte resident who attended East Tennessee State. He is very comfy in this part of the country. It hasn’t translated to a whole lot of success at the Wyndham (3-for-4 with one finish better than 60th). However, he did land a 27th-place finish here last year and arrives in the best form of his life this time around.
